102 Merlin Drive, Quedgeley, Gloucester, GL2 4NL is a freehold detached property built between 1996-2002. The property offers approximately 1,744 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have six b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£418,844 , which equates to approximately £240 per square foot. It was last sold on 23 Jul 2015 for £265,000. Since then, the value has increased by £153,844, representing a 58.1% increase, or approximately 5.6% per year.

The current estimated value of £418,844 is:

  • 5.3% lower than the average property price on Merlin Drive
  • 7.8% lower than the average in the GL2 4NL postcode area
  • and 52.4% higher than the average price for Gloucester as a whole

Based on EPC inspection history, this property has been mostly owner-occupied (4 out of 4 inspections). This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 24 November 2015,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

102 Merlin Drive, Quedgeley, Gloucester, Gloucestershire, GL2 4NL has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 24 Nov 2015.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from the main heating system, though the cylinder has no thermostat.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 3 Nov 2015, when the property was rated D. The current rating of E re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 29.4%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system was changed from from main system to from main system, no cylinder thermostat, with its energy efficiency changing from average to poor.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, 75 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(average).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to very po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in all f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 61% of fixed outlets, with efficiency changing from very good to good.
